UP URBAN Development Minister Azam Khan’s statement that seers will be provided with five-star-hotel facilities at the Sangam during Ardh Kumbh in January 2007, invited severe criticism.

Maa Ganga Pradushan Mukti Abhiyan Samiti Bharat (MGPMASB) president Swami Harichaitanya Brahmachari demanded an unconditional apology from the minister.
At a meeting of officers held recently in Lucknow to review preparation of Ardh Kumbh, Khan announced that seers would be provided with facilities of a five star hotel during Ardh Kumbh in 2007. In a press release issued here on Monday, he said that Khan, instead of taking any concrete steps towards cleaning the Ganga for pure water offered five-star hotel facilities to the seers.
He said that Khan should know that the seers and pilgrims who congregate at the Sangam had no interest in worldly pleasures.
He termed the statement of Khan as disgraceful and demanded an apology from him. MGPMASB spokesperson Omkarnath Tripathi also criticised the statement of Khan. He said that the government, instead of concentrating on cleaning the Ganga during the Kumbh, was seeking the services of foreign engineers to provide the pilgrims and seers with five-star hotel facilities in the Sangam area.
He suggested the minister should learn the art of construction of temples and ashrams. The seers resented the luxurious preparations for Ardh Kumbh.
